On a PlayStation 3 Delay

Sony’s new video game console, the PlayStation 3, may see its release in the United States delayed until early 2007, according to various reports. The eye-opening new data on the PlayStation 3 is that Sony will likely spend $900 per console in manufacturing costs. On Recasting Remington Steele

As I mentioned a few months ago, Pierce Brosnan has expressed an interest in reviving Remington Steele, the 1980s mystery-comedy television series that provided his breakout role, as a feature film.
